Abstract

In the present paper the authors describe in detail a palm petiole, Palmocaulon monodii sp. nov., from the Eocene of Senegal. Attempt has been made to identify the petiole with the modern genera of palms but due to lack of detailed studies on the anatomy of palm petioles, it has not been possible to do so.
